God In Your Brain

Source: Daily Mail

Scientist Dr. Andrew Newberg conducted brain scans on people during prayer, meditation and other religious, rituals, and various trance states.

He is a proponent of a controversial field of science known as neurotheology, which tries to study the relationship between the brain and religion.

As part of his research, Newberg studied the brain activity of experienced Tibetan Buddhists before and during meditation.

Newberg found an increase of activity in the meditators' frontal lobe, responsible for focusing attention and concentration, during meditation. He attributes the change to the effects of their religious experience.
